Professional Pest Control Services Across Huron-Perth

Huron County and Perth County sit in the heart of southwestern Ontario's agricultural belt, where some of the province's most productive farmland meets the Lake Huron shoreline. This landscape creates distinct pest pressures: agricultural operations generate massive rodent and insect populations that overflow into nearby homes during harvest. Lake Huron moisture drives carpenter ant and spider infestations in Goderich, Bayfield, and Grand Bend. Heritage housing stock in Stratford and St. Marys — with century-old foundations and deteriorated mortar — provides easy entry for mice and insects. Blacklegged ticks carrying Lyme disease are established in woodlands and transitional habitats across both counties.

2025 Pest Control Costs in Huron-Perth

Pest control costs in Stratford, Goderich, and Listowel are comparable to other mid-size southwestern Ontario communities. Lake Huron cottage properties and remote rural locations may include travel surcharges.

Mice and Rat Control

Rodent control is the most common service, peaking October through March as cold weather and harvest displacement drive mice indoors.

  • Initial inspection and trapping: $200-$350
  • Exclusion and sealing: $300-$600
  • Full removal program (trapping + exclusion): $400-$800
  • Cottage winterization exclusion: $300-$500
  • Rural property rodent program: $400-$900

Older Stratford and St. Marys homes often need extensive exclusion. Rural properties near crop fields face harvest-driven migration pressure in fall.

Carpenter Ant Treatment

Avon River moisture and Lake Huron humidity create conditions that favour carpenter ants throughout the region.

  • Inspection and assessment: $100-$200
  • Standard treatment (localized): $400-$800
  • Extensive infestation (multiple sites): $800-$1,500
  • Annual prevention program: $300-$600

Moisture remediation is often needed alongside treatment, especially for heritage properties and lakefront homes.

Bed Bug and Cockroach Treatment

Tourism accommodation and rental housing in Stratford and Goderich drive demand for these services.

  • Bed bug heat treatment (1-2 rooms): $1,200-$2,000
  • Bed bug heat treatment (whole home): $2,000-$3,500
  • Bed bug chemical treatment (2-3 visits): $800-$1,500
  • Cockroach gel bait treatment: $250-$500
  • Cockroach multi-unit program: $150-$300 per unit

Stratford Festival tourism season creates seasonal bed bug introduction risk. Multi-unit buildings require coordinated treatment.

Wildlife and Wasp Removal

Agricultural landscape and Lake Huron shoreline support active wildlife populations throughout Huron-Perth.

  • Wasp nest removal: $150-$700
  • Raccoon removal and exclusion: $800-$2,000
  • Squirrel removal and exclusion: $600-$1,500
  • Skunk exclusion: $500-$1,200
  • Bat exclusion: $800-$2,500

Wildlife removal must comply with Ontario's Fish and Wildlife Conservation Act. Baby season restrictions apply April through June.

What Affects Pest Control Costs in Huron-Perth?

  • Housing Age and Condition: Heritage homes in Stratford and St. Marys need more extensive exclusion. Deteriorated mortar, settling foundations, and aging seals create multiple entry points that increase initial costs but reduce long-term expenses.
  • Lake Huron Proximity: Shoreline properties in Goderich, Bayfield, and Grand Bend face elevated moisture and pest pressure requiring dehumidification and drainage alongside pest treatment.
  • Agricultural Proximity: Properties near crop fields face harvest-driven rodent migration and elevated insect pressure. Perimeter treatments timed to harvest season help manage agricultural pest crossover.
  • Pest Species and Severity: Simple mouse exclusion costs less than treating a multi-point invasion. Carpenter ant treatment depends on colony size and accessibility. Bed bug costs vary by severity and treatment method.

Why are pest problems common in older Stratford and St. Marys homes?

Stratford and St. Marys have significant heritage housing stock with stone or brick foundations where mortar has deteriorated over a century or more. These foundations have gaps, cracks, and settling that provide direct entry points for mice, carpenter ants, and other pests. Original windows and door frames no longer seal tightly. Wooden sill plates often rest directly on masonry without modern moisture barriers. Comprehensive exclusion — sealing every gap, crack, and penetration — is essential for lasting pest control in these older properties.

Are ticks a concern in Huron-Perth?

Yes. Blacklegged ticks carrying Lyme disease have expanded their range into Huron and Perth Counties. Tick populations are established in woodlands, riparian corridors along the Avon River and its tributaries, and transitional habitats between agricultural fields and forested areas. Lake Huron shoreline recreation areas also support tick populations. Tick activity peaks May through July for nymphs and October through November for adults. Property management including short grass, brush clearing, and tick checks after outdoor activities are essential prevention measures.

Does agricultural activity affect pest pressure in homes?

Yes, significantly. Huron-Perth is one of Ontario's most productive agricultural regions, with extensive grain, livestock, and row crop operations. These create massive rodent populations that migrate to nearby homes during fall harvest when crop removal eliminates field cover and food sources. Cluster flies that parasitize earthworms in agricultural soils are a major nuisance pest. Insect populations from farming operations overflow into nearby residential areas. Properties near crop fields face consistently higher pest pressure than urban homes.
